Full Ingredient List

wheat flour, margarine (palm oil, soybean oil, water, salt, mono - and diglycerides, mono - and diglycerides, mixed tocopherols [antioxidant], ascorbic acid [antioxidant], citric acid [antioxidant]), soy lecithin (an emulsifier), natural flavor, annatto extract [color], turmeric oleoresin [color], vitamin A palmitate), brown sugar, dextrose, white chocolate (sugar, unsweetened chocolate, cocoa butter, milk, nonfat milk, soy lecithin [an emulsifier], natural flavor), sugar, palm kernel oil, cocoa (processed with alkali), invert sugar, eggs, natural and artificial flavors, salt, xanthan gum, sunflower lecithin, baking soda, caramel color, baking powder (sodium acid pyrophosphate, sodium bicarbonate, corn starch, monocalcium phosphate), tapioca syrup, tapioca starch, chocolate cookie pieces (sugar, enriched flour [wheat flour, niacin, reduced iron, thiamine mononitrate, riboflavin, folic acid], palm and palm kernel oil, cocoa [processed with alkali], salt, soy lecithin, chocolate, baking soda, natural flavor), chocolate chips (sugar, chocolate, cocoa butter, soy lecithin, natural flavor), water, eggs, fructose, invert syrup, salt, natural vanilla flavor, baking soda, natural flavor, cellulose gum, starch (rice, tapioca), vegetable fiber (flaxseed), pea protein, rice flour
